Kedung Sumber village has an area of 227.90 rice farming land with a production of 1595.30 tons. Law no. 6 of 2014 explains that village development is an effort to improve the quality of life for the greatest welfare of the village community by utilizing the potential of the village. Kedung Sumber Village also has several potential natural beauty that can be a natural tourist destination. This study aims to determine the potential of the village and community participation to improve community welfare. This study uses a qualitative descriptive method approach with percentage analysis techniques. Data collection methods are observation, questionnaires, and documentation. The result of the research is that Kedung Sumber village has several potentials that can be developed, namely natural beauty, rice commodities, and non-physical potential in the form of institutions, government, and community enthusiasm in supporting several activities in the village. The most dominant form of community participation in Kedung Sumber village is social participation and the least is skill participation. Efforts to improve community welfare through local potential are increasing community participation in the form of labor participation as the priority and the second priority is developing non-physical potential.
